PCM(Pulse Code Modulation),即脉冲编码调制,是一种数字信号处理技术,也是将模拟信号数字化的最基本形式。PCM编解码是一种数字信号编解码技术,将模拟信号转化为数字信号,使得数字信号能够在计算机等数字设备上进行处理、传输等。
PCM编码是通过对信号进行抽样、量化、编码等步骤实现的。首先对连续的模拟信号进行抽样,即指定时间间隔内取样一次,将每次取样记录为一个样本值。接着对样本值进行量化,将其映射为离散的量化值,用二进制数表示。最后将量化值转换为二进制数,并传输或存储起来。PCM编码在数字音频传输、计算机语音、数字电视等领域广泛应用。
PCM解码是将PCM编码的数字信号还原为模拟信号的过程。解码时需要进行反向处理,即将二进制数转换为量化值,再将量化值映射到模拟信号的幅度值,最终合成模拟信号。解码过程需要逆转编码过程的每一步骤,还需要考虑传输时可能发生的误差。PCM解码的质量取决于数字信号的编码精度和传输通道的质量。PCM解码在数字音频播放、计算机语音识别、数字电视等领域得到广泛应用。
随着数字音频、视频等技术的快速发展,PCM编解码技术也在不断创新。随着数字音频技术的普及,在保证音质的同时,对数据压缩技术的要求越来越高,PCM编解码技术也在不断优化,出现了一些新的数字音频编码格式。例如无损数码音频格式Flac,可以在不损失音质的前提下进行高压缩比的编码。此外,还有一些新的数字音频编码方式,如DSD编码、DXD编码等,以期在保证音质的情况下提升传输效率。随着数字音频技术的不断创新和发展,PCM编解码将会继续扮演着重要的角色。